I want to become a more skilled programmer. I also want to do it through Objective-C and iOS.

What websites or programs that you know of have problems that I can solve (with the answers)? I have failed some programming tests for jobs (such as "Given 2 values in a Binary Tree - how do you find the lowest common ancestor?) and I want to become a better engineer.

I have developed 54 iOS/Android apps to date, but my core CS Skills apparently are rusty/bad.

I have looked at TopCoder - but there aren't very many competitions going on, the website is terrible, and there does not appear to be anything that really supports Objective-C/iOS
